Output 9c16c2ad31c14ba14e03ad9ee7c7186b973ec91fe4d0b503b89118fee20ccf86:4

value
53298000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866bfbbcaa22da1d51b45814353d9e47a0647a87 OP_EQUAL
address
3Dwmq4e38J2xK9BwFz1DYaSVZ3M6jw9uNn
transaction
9c16c2ad31c14ba14e03ad9ee7c7186b973ec91fe4d0b503b89118fee20ccf86
spent
true